    You can't just close a post and call it good

    Support locks threads because it's easier for them to see a new thread than a reply to an old one.

    There were no offers to receive credits just for preordering The Division digitally. There were 2 different games on demand punchcards it could have qualified for if purchased at the right time, but you would have had to make other eligible purchases to
    complete the offer and receive credits. Otherwise, it would have had to be preordered as a physical disc from Microsoftstore.com in order to receive credits.

    XBLRewards8 Guest
    Hello LEONHART7676,

    As Smwutches says, we lock posts to encourage users to create new posts, as older posts have a tendency to get buried. We have also found that users have issues finding older posts.

    If you would like clarification on specific offers, please note which ones you are confused on. On your previous post at (My balance seems wrong and tells me i have 0 games played.)
    you did not specify any particulars on your account. We verified that all your account details are in order, and attempted to clarify any general details we felt you may have been confused with.

    As Smwutches says, The Division offer was for physical disc purchases made from MicrosoftStore.com, as indicated in the email that was sent out to users. Since your purchase was digital, it did not qualify for that offer.

    The opt-out link provided is accurate. You can also find an opt-out link at the bottom of your MyRewards page.
